Ashelle's Video

521 River Rd, Grand Rapids, R0C 1E0 ,Canada
Ashelle's Video Ashelle's Video is one of the popular Movie & Music Store located in 521 River Rd ,Grand Rapids listed under Local business in Grand Rapids , Shopping/retail in Grand Rapids ,

Contact Details & Working Hours

Map of Ashelle's Video